The All Blacks managed to hold on to their record at Eden Park, largely thanks to Beauden Barrett's performance.

The veteran fullback's 125th test match offered a game-changing 29 minutes of tactical kicking as well as setting up the go-ahead try by Mark Tele'a - leading to a 24-17 win over England.
